I hadn’t given this any conscious thought in so many years, but I feel like I used to write in Third Person Omniscient most of the time and now I’m almost always Third Person Limited and past tense. I don’t even know where I’d start with anything else!
I used to write in a lazy Third Person Semi-Omniscient Head-Hopping style, in like, 2000, but I very deliberately trained myself out of it by writing a novel in 1st person with the full intention of rewriting it in 3rd, in about 2003. So.
At this point I have no idea how I’d even try to do Omniscient. I don’t know. I don’t think I could. Point of view is like– the entire framing device from which I consider fictional events, now. I often genuinely don’t know what the non-POV characters are seeing or feeling. I don’t know how I’d even try.
I could research it, but at this point I just– I feel like my energies are better expended just writing like I do, for now?
But i feel you. I don’t know how to do other than I do. I feel like I’m past that kind of stylistic experimentation. I did present tense and second person and shit like that when I was Trying To Master The Craft etc., and now I’m really just drowning in trying to tell a dang story and I don’t have time to think about that stuff.
